Maintaining Skin Health on a Budget

Prioritize a gentle cleanser and moisturizer suited for your skin type. Look for drugstore brands offering quality ingredients like hyaluronic acid or ceramides. These basic products form the cornerstone of a healthy skincare routine.

Sun protection is paramount. A broad-spectrum SPF 30 sunscreen is your best friend, regardless of budget. Many affordable options are available at pharmacies and supermarkets. Reapply every two hours, especially after swimming or sweating.

Exfoliate once or twice a week to remove dead skin cells. A simple DIY sugar scrub (sugar and honey) works wonders, or choose a budget-friendly chemical exfoliant containing salicylic acid or glycolic acid.

Hydration is key. Drinking plenty of water throughout the day promotes healthy, radiant skin. This simple step is entirely free and incredibly beneficial.

Consider your diet. A balanced diet rich in fruits and vegetables provides essential vitamins and nutrients that support skin health. Focus on whole foods instead of expensive supplements.

Adjust your skincare based on your needs. Seasonal changes and stress can impact your skin. Be flexible and adapt your routine as needed. Small adjustments can make a big difference.

Product Category Budget-Friendly Options Tips
Cleanser CeraVe, Cetaphil Choose a gentle formula that avoids harsh sulfates.
Moisturizer Neutrogena Hydro Boost, Aveeno Select a moisturizer that addresses your skin’s specific concerns (dry, oily, acne-prone).
Sunscreen Superdrug, La Roche-Posay Anthelios (check for sales) Look for broad-spectrum protection and a high SPF.

Remember consistency is crucial. A simple, well-maintained routine is more effective than a complex, expensive one. Be patient and observe your skin’s response to the changes you make.
